How much do software engineer software eng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 10, 2026, the average yearly pay for software engineer software engineer in Myrtle Point, OR is $138,332.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$112,500.00 and $162,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Software Engineer Software Engineer vs Web Developer?

AspectSoftware EngineerWeb Developer
Required CredentialsBachelor's in CS or related field, certifications like Microsoft, AWSBachelor's in CS, Web Development, or related field; certifications vary
Work EnvironmentSoftware development teams, offices, remote optionsWeb development teams, agencies, freelance work
Industry UsageTech, finance, healthcare, many sectorsDigital agencies, startups, e-commerce
Common Search/ComparisonOften compared for coding skills and project scopeCompared for front-end/back-end focus and design skills

Software Engineers and Web Developers both create software solutions, but Software Engineers typically work on a broader range of applications across various industries, focusing on system architecture and backend development. Web Developers specialize in building websites and web applications, often with a focus on front-end design or back-end functionality. Both roles require coding skills and collaboration, but their work environments and project types differ.

Purpose of Role
  • Provide quality and performant data modeling and visualizations solutions to our cross functional business units which represent the mantra, "Business First; Technology Second."
  • As part of a results-oriented team, participate in the design, implementation, maintenance and support of our modernized data platform to enable the business to make better, more informed decisions.
  • Work closely with Enterprise Data Analysts, Data Platform Engineers, Data Governance Team within Enterprise Data. Management Organization to help define, develop and implement solutions and provide services for the enterprise applications.
  • Model, design, develop, test and implement the appropriate backend and front-end structures needed to meet business visualization and reporting requirements.
  • Leverage industry-leading integration and analytics tools to build a modern data warehouse that is accurate, reliable, high performing and easily accessible to our business departments.
  • Build dashboard to follow wireframes designs, integrate with backend data models. Build aggregate data models. Manage the data flow to reflect in dashboards to meet business requirements.
  • Data formatting and processing to build the foundation layer for dashboards and self-service reporting. Work on data transformation, using the ETL tools. Build dimension views and fact tables.
  • Interact with the client business community to gather/develop functional and technical requirements and translate them into reporting solutions.
  • Responsible for the full life cycle of development, from requirements gathering through data transformation coding and report/dashboard design and creation.
  • Follow development standards in accordance with UA best practices.
  • Work with Enterprise Data Analysts team to clarify functional requirements and create the TSD's.
  • Data formatting and processing to build the foundation layer for dashboards and self-service reporting.
  • Troubleshoot data anomalies with engineering teams.
  • Work on data transformation, using the ETL tools. Build dimension views and fact tables.
  • Responsible for daily support of the data warehouse and associated data marts.
  • Coordinate with Data Platform Engineering team, Enterprise Data Analyst Team, Data Governance Team, and IT. Teams to align with change management processes and to ensure performance, processes and access is optimal for our global reporting solutions.
  • Work collaboratively to align business requirements with reporting and analytical solutions.
  • Improve processes regarding data flow and quality to improve data accuracy, viability and value.
  • Document development for peer reference and knowledge transfer.
  • Interact with the client business community to gather/develop functional and technical requirements and translate them into visualization solutions.
  • Educate and empower the business community towards self-serve reporting model.
  • Other duties as assigned within area of responsibility.
Qualifications

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Systems or related technical field. Followed by 5 years of progressively responsible experience in a Software Engineering role (e.g. Project Lead, Senior Software Engineer, Software Engineer, etc.).

  • 2 years of experience developing and supporting the SAP HANA, Business Objects, and SAC platform stack to ensure performance, process, access is optimal for the global reporting solution.
  • 2 years of experience in Technical design of Data Modelling for SAC Analytics to Support the ongoing Business requirements formulation process for Enterprise Business Analytics operations.
  • 3 years of experience in design and development of analytical queries, reports and visualizations utilizing the Tableau Platform.
  • 2 years of Experience with dbt as a data orchestration tool.
  • 2 years of experience working in CICD framework.
  • 2 years of experience with Snowflake VWH and data modeling.
  • Demonstrated knowledge* of:
    • HVR replication for data ingestion.
    • Python and Java programming.
    • Fundamental data architecture and design.
    • SQL and strong data transformation.

*Knowledge may be demonstrated through education, training and/or experience
